Attendance Woes: Deer Hill has an attendance problem, and we're hoping to partner with you on minimizing voluntary absences and early dismissals which spike on Fridays. Please take a look at the chart below and recognize the impact these absences and dismissals have on not only the students who are not in school, but those who are left behind -- teachers are left with a no-win decision of teaching new content that will then have to be revisited or modifying academic pacing which makes it difficult to meet the instructional requirements of grade level standards. Layered on that is the ringing of the phone sometimes 5, 6, or more times on a Friday afternoon in a given classroom with students being summoned for dismissal. While we (many of us are parents, travelers, skiers, etc.) understand the importance of family time and cultural experiences, the high rate of absenteeism and mass exodus on Fridays negatively impacts the morale and culture of our school community as well as our ability to provide the high quality education to which our staff strives. As a final thought to put things in context, on a typical midweek school day, (I ran the report for Wednesday, February 5), we had 7 unexcused absences and 2 dismissals, equaling 2% of our student population. Thank you for taking these points into consideration as you make plans for your family. More information including Massachusetts law and School Committee policy can be found in our Deer Hill Handbook beginning on page 10.

Responsible Risk Taking Challenge
Encourage your child to take one new step into independence. This will look different for children of all ages. For an early elementary kiddo, getting their own breakfast might be a new level of independence. For an upper elementary student, trying to do all of their homework on their own might be new. For a middle school student, maybe it's staying home alone. For a high schooler, maybe it's making their own doctor or dentist appointment. Only you will know what's right for your child, but encourage them to try something they've always done with you or that you've done for them, without you.
